Understanding Casino Games: A Diverse Landscape

The sheer variety of casino games can be overwhelming for newcomers. From classic table games like blackjack, roulette, and poker to the dazzling array of slot machines and video poker, there’s something to suit every preference. Each game operates on unique rules and probabilities, offering different levels of skill involvement and potential payouts. Understanding these distinctions is the first step towards informed gameplay. The house edge, a concept central to casino mathematics, represents the statistical advantage the casino holds over players in the long run. This edge varies significantly between games, influencing the odds of winning.

The Appeal of Slot Machines

Slot machines, perhaps the most iconic symbol of the casino, remain immensely popular due to their simplicity and potential for large payouts. Modern slots have evolved far beyond the traditional three-reel mechanical devices, incorporating captivating graphics, bonus rounds, and progressive jackpots. These features enhance the entertainment value, but it’s important to remember that slot machines are primarily games of chance. While choosing machines with higher payout percentages can marginally improve your odds, the outcome of each spin is ultimately determined by a random number generator (RNG). The rapid play nature of slots means it’s possible to lose track of spending very quickly, making responsible bankroll management essential.

Strategies for slot play are limited, largely centered around understanding the paytable and choosing machines that align with your risk tolerance. Exploring different themes and bonus features can enhance the enjoyment, but avoid the misconception that there’s a guaranteed way to “beat” the slots. It’s crucial to view slot machine play as a form of entertainment, with any winnings considered a pleasant surprise.

Table Games: Skill and Strategy

Unlike slots, table games often involve an element of skill and strategic decision-making. Blackjack, for example, allows players to influence the outcome through informed choices regarding hitting, standing, doubling down, and splitting pairs. A basic strategy chart, widely available online, outlines the statistically optimal plays for every possible hand combination. While mastering basic strategy doesn’t guarantee wins, it significantly reduces the house edge. Poker, similarly, demands a strong understanding of hand rankings, pot odds, and opponent psychology. Success in poker relies heavily on skill and the ability to read and anticipate your adversaries.

Game House Edge (Approximate) Skill Level
Blackjack (Basic Strategy) 0.5% – 1% High
Roulette (American) 5.26% Low
Baccarat 1.06% (Banker Bet) Low
Slot Machines 2% – 15% Very Low

Responsible Gambling: Playing Safely and Sensibly

The excitement of the casino can be intoxicating, but it’s imperative to prioritize responsible gambling practices. Setting a budget before you begin and sticking to it is paramount. Never gamble with money you can’t afford to lose, and avoid chasing losses, as this can quickly lead to financial distress. Treat casino gaming as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Recognize the signs of problem gambling, such as spending increasing amounts of time and money, lying about your gambling activities, or experiencing negative consequences in your personal or professional life.

Recognizing Problem Gambling

Problem gambling is a serious issue that can have devastating consequences for individuals and their families. The warning signs are often subtle at first, but progressively worsen over time. These can include preoccupation with gambling, an inability to control or reduce gambling behavior, lying to conceal the extent of gambling activities, and experiencing feelings of guilt, shame, or depression. Financial difficulties, relationship problems, and job loss are common consequences of problem gambling.

If you suspect that you or someone you know may have a gambling problem, seeking help is crucial. Numerous resources are available, including self-exclusion programs, counseling services, and support groups. Don’t hesitate to reach out for assistance. Taking the first step towards recovery can be challenging, but it’s an essential investment in your well-being.

Setting Limits and Staying in Control

Proactive strategies for responsible gambling include setting both time and monetary limits. Decide how much money you’re willing to spend before you enter the casino and avoid exceeding that amount. Similarly, set a time limit for your session and stick to it. Take frequent breaks to avoid getting caught up in the excitement. Never gamble under the influence of alcohol or drugs, as these can impair your judgment. Utilize the casino’s responsible gambling tools, such as self-exclusion programs, which allow you to ban yourself from the facility for a specified period.

The Rise of Online Casinos

Online casinos offer a wide array of games, mirroring the offerings found in traditional brick-and-mortar establishments. However, the convenience and accessibility of online gambling come with inherent risks. Ensuring the legitimacy of an online casino is paramount. Look for casinos that are licensed and regulated by reputable authorities, and verify that they employ robust security measures to protect your personal and financial information. Read reviews and check for any complaints before depositing funds. Be wary of bonuses and promotions that seem too good to be true, as they may come with restrictive wagering requirements.

Furthermore, it’s important to practice responsible gambling habits when playing online. Setting deposit limits, utilizing time management tools, and taking frequent breaks can help prevent problem gambling. Be aware of the potential for addiction and seek help if you feel your gambling is becoming unmanageable.

Innovations in Casino Technology

Technological innovation continues to reshape the casino industry. Smart cards and loyalty programs allow casinos to track player behavior and offer personalized rewards. Advanced surveillance systems enhance security and deter cheating, while biometric technologies are being explored for identity verification.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ies hold the potential to create immersive casino experiences, blurring the lines between the physical and digital worlds. The integration of blockchain technology and cryptocurrencies is also gaining traction, offering increased transparency and security.
